No Till Selection
No Till Selection refers to cannabis breeding and cultivation lineages developed within regenerative soil systems that avoid mechanical tilling. Breeders working with this category often select for plants demonstrating resilience in living soil environments, where root architecture, microbial symbiosis, and nutrient cycling efficiency influence phenotypic expression. This approach emphasizes genetic traits suited to biological soil management rather than chemical inputs. Lineage records frequently report selections from this category exhibit adaptive vigor in undisturbed substrate conditions. The practice reflects a growing intersection between sustainable cultivation methods and targeted plant selection criteria.
